Singer Nikhita Gandhi defends Badshah in ‘Tateeree’ controversy: 'Many have done inappropriate stuff, none were held'

Indian music sensation Nikhita Gandhi has sparked a debate by coming out in support of rapper Badshah, who has been embroiled in a controversy surrounding his Haryanvi song ‘Tateeree’. The song, which was released recently, has been accused of objectifying women and perpetuating negative stereotypes. In a bold move, Nikhita Gandhi, known for her chart-topping collaborations with Badshah on tracks like ‘Jugnu’ and ‘O Sajna’, has defended the rapper, saying that he is not the only one responsible for ‘inappropriate stuff’ in the industry.

Supporting Her Colleague

Gandhi took to social media to express her solidarity with Badshah, stating that many artists have been guilty of similar transgressions but have faced little to no repercussions. She emphasized that her statement is not an attempt to justify or condone Badshah’s actions but rather to highlight the glaring double standards in the industry. ‘Many have done inappropriate stuff, none were held accountable. Why is it that only one person gets blamed and judged?’ she questioned.

The singer’s comments have sparked a heated debate among fans and fellow artists, with some supporting her stance and others condemning her for ‘standing up for someone who is clearly in the wrong’. However, Gandhi remains resolute in her support for Badshah, citing the importance of giving artists a chance to grow and learn from their mistakes.
